
Beyoncé is playing no games this time around. King Bey just dropped one of her songs from her yet to be released, yet highly anticipated album.
The song “Bow Down/ I Been On” shows a new side of Beyoncé, a side we haven’t seen since her days of Destiny’s Child. She got real “Texas Trill” with the new track where she drops lines like “I know when you were little girls you dreamt of being in my world Don’t forget it, don’t forget it. Bow down bitches.”
The sassy Beyoncé continues on singing:
“I took some time to live my life but don’t think I am just his little wife. Don’t get it twisted this is my shit, bow down bitches.”
Well damn, Beyoncé came to snatch wigs with her crown on!
The new song is not only a reminder that Beyoncé is still reining king, but it is also paying some serious homage to her hometown of the H-Town.
This is also the first listen to the song that plays in the background of her promo video for the Mrs. Carter World Tour.
